Moisture Mapping is a critical practice in various industries to identify and address moisture-related issues. Specialized equipment is utilized to accurately detect and quantify moisture levels, ensuring optimal conditions and preventing costly consequences.
Moisture Monitoring Equipment
A range of moisture monitoring equipment is available to meet diverse requirements:
- Moisture Meters: Handheld devices that provide instant moisture readings. They utilize different technologies, such as capacitance, resistance, and microwave, to measure moisture content in various materials.
- Hygrometers: Instruments that measure the relative humidity of the air. They are often used in conjunction with moisture meters to provide a comprehensive understanding of moisture levels in a specific environment.
- Thermal Imaging Cameras: Non-invasive tools that detect temperature differences. They can identify areas with higher moisture levels, as moisture tends to alter the thermal properties of materials.
- Leak Detection Equipment: Specialized sensors or cameras that detect water leaks and moisture intrusion. They are particularly useful in identifying hidden leaks that may otherwise go unnoticed.
Do Moisture Meters Really Work?
Moisture meters are widely used for moisture detection, but their accuracy and effectiveness are often questioned. Here are factors that influence their reliability:
- Material Sensitivity: Moisture meters may not be equally effective in measuring moisture levels in all materials. The type of material and its moisture content range can impact the accuracy of readings.
- Calibration: Proper calibration and maintenance are crucial for accurate readings. Moisture meters should be calibrated regularly to ensure their precision and reliability.
- User Skill: The skill and experience of the user can affect the accuracy of moisture meter readings. Proper training and understanding of the equipment are essential for reliable results.
Despite these considerations, moisture meters remain valuable tools when used correctly. They provide quick and non-destructive measurements, allowing for timely detection and mitigation of moisture-related issues.
